Hotel Management

The Hospitality and Tourism Industry is one of the fastest growing service sector not only in India but worldwide. The WorldTravel and Tourism Council forecasts Indian tourism sector to grow at annual growth rate of 7 per cent over the next ten years with this Hospitality industry will also see a tremendous growth.

Career in Hospitality Industry:

The hospitality industry offers a wide range of exciting job opportunities. Although many people immediately think about hotel work when they hear the word “hospitality,” but if you truly want to capitalize on all that this industry has to offer then have a look at the following areas for your career:

A tour company; An International cruise line; Airline and railway hospitality managers; Casinos; Ministry of Tourism; Event managers; Luxury resorts; Spas and wellness Centres; Museums and cultural venues; Catering Companies etc

You can even establish your own tour company or hotel chains or catering company and many more.

NCHMCT

National Council for Hotel Management and Catering Technology (Society) was set up in the year 1982 by the Government of India as an autonomous body for coordinated growth and development of hospitality education in the country. The Council regulates academics activities in the field of Hospitality Education & Training that is imparted through Twenty One (21) Central Govt. sponsored Institutes of Hotel Management (IHM), Twenty One (21) State Government sponsored institutes, fifteen (15) Private institutes and Seven (7) Food Craft Institutes, that function in different parts of the country.

At Undergraduate level it offers a 3 year full time program B.SC in Hospitality and Hotel Management which is recognised as the best degree course in the field of Hotel Management in India.

Eligibility:

  • A pass in 10+2 system of Senior Secondary examination or its equivalent with English as one of the subjects.
  • For candidates from General and OBC categories, upper age limit is 22 years as on 01.07.2017.

Admission Process: Selection through written Test called Joint Entrance Examination (NCHMCT- JEE). No GD and PI.

Written Test Pattern: Objective Type

Each Question carries 1 mark and there is a negative marking of 0.25 for every incorrect answer except  for Aptitude for service sector section.

Total: 200 Questions

Duration: 3 hours

Total Seats: 8000(approx.)
